Genetic variants associated with angiotensin-converting enzyme inhibitor-induced cough: a genome-wide association study in a Swedish population.

Hallberg P, Persson M, Axelsson T et al.

Aim: We conducted a genome-wide association study on angiotensin-converting enzyme inhibitor-induced cough and used our dataset to replicate candidate genes identified in previous studies.

123 European ancestry cases, 1,345 European and unknown ancestry controls, 1 Middle Eastern ancestry case
